Output e8c2b0269f2fca6a856d2ac314aa7ea6f13fdc0f3628b8929979df1653e8e78f:1

value
20528000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1217aa330e54484d84d411402a0db26c01ad57b OP_EQUAL
address
A8arNWUo7oraA56FGjiEjAAEVeU3F3w1V9
transaction
e8c2b0269f2fca6a856d2ac314aa7ea6f13fdc0f3628b8929979df1653e8e78f